Here's what you'll need: shower curtain, cotton flannel or wool flannel, (a friend told me that a 100% cotton T-shirt will work also, plain with no writing or pictures on it), 1 quart bottle of castor oil, enough plastic to cover the abdomen, 1 or 2 towels, and a sheet (these last two items need to be items that you can throw away later because the castor oil will stain them and doesn't come out. If you are doing the packs over several weeks or months, put the pack in a baggie and keep it the refridgerator so that it doesn't go rancid on you.

Here's the protocol.  Put the plastic shower curtain down on a bed, then a sheet over the plastic. Take your pack flannel or T-shirt and start pouring on the castor oil, but do not get it dripping wet; just enough to cover well.  The size of the pack depends on the area to be covered.  You can purchase the size that would cover just the right side of the abdomen over the liver and ascending colon.  If you want to cover the whole abdomen then you will need to cut it out of a plain white flannel sheet or T-shirt, and you will need 2 to 4 layers.  Place the pack over your abdomen, cover with the plastic and one of the towels over the plastic.  Then put your heating pad over the towel.  You want the heating pad to stay on for at least an hour to 1-1/2 hours. The extra towel is to use just in case you get chilled, so this can be a beach-sized towel to cover with.  This is to be done for 3 consecutive days or nights, and the morning after the third night, you take olive oil to stimulate the liver.  You can take 1/4 or 1/2 teaspoon and take some every 3 to 4 hours during this day.  If you know how to ask the body what it needs then do so, or keep doing them until you reach your desired results.  If it's a chronic condition, this can take several months to a year, so don't give up.  I will be doing a video on Youtube in the near future instructing you on how to do this.
